COOLING SYSTEM
Debris may clog the engine's air cooling system. Remove
the blower housing and clean the areas shown in Figure 31
to prevent overheating and engine damage.

ENGINE OIL
1. Make sure the trowel is on a secure, level surface with
the engine stopped.
DIPSTICK
Figure 32. Engine Oil Dipstick
2. Pull the engine oil dipstick (Figure 32) out of its holder
and wipe it with a clean rag.
3. Fully insert the dipstick then remove it again.
4. Determine if engine oil is low. Oil should be between
the upper and lower marks (Figure 32) on the dipstick.

5. If the oil is below the lower mark on the dipstick, remove
the oil filler cap (Figure 33) and add engine oil up to
the upper mark on the dipstick. Refer to Table 6 for
recommended oil viscosity.

CAUTION
NEVER overfill the oil pan. ALWAYS allow time for
any added oil to make its way to the oil pan before
rechecking the level.
6. When replacing the dipstick, make sure it is fully
inserted into its holder to keep the crankcase sealed.
Changing Engine Oil and Filter
Change the engine oil after the first 5 to 8 hours of operation,
then every 100 hours. Change the oil every 50 hours when
operating under heavy load or in high temperatures. Refer
to Table 6 for recommended oil viscosity.
NOTICE
ALWAYS drain the engine oil while the oil is warm.
1. Make sure the engine is level.
2. Disconnect the spark plug wire and keep it away from
the spark plugs.
3. Disconnect the negative (black) battery cable from the
negative battery terminal.
